A Day in Your Life at MKS: As a Logistics Specialist at Atotech Thailand, you will partner with cross-functional teams including Procurement, Operations, and Customer Service to support and optimize logistics operations across transportation, warehousing, inventory management, and vendor coordination. In this role, you will report to the Supply Chain Manager. You Will Make an Impact By: Data Analysis: Collecting, analyzing, and interpreting logistics data to support decision-making and improve operational efficiency. Reporting: Creating regular reports and dashboards to monitor KPIs such as delivery performance, inventory accuracy, and transportation costs. Process Improvement: Identifying inefficiencies in logistics workflows and contributing to initiatives that enhance productivity and reduce costs. Inventory Management: Monitoring inventory levels, conducting cycle counts, reconciling discrepancies, and supporting forecasting activities. Vendor Management: Assisting in the evaluation, selection, and relationship management of logistics vendors and service providers. Documentation and Compliance: Ensuring accuracy and completeness of logistics documentation, including customs records and compliance certificates. Systems and Tools: Using logistics software to track shipments, manage inventory, and analyze performance; supporting system upgrades or implementations. Cross-Functional Collaboration: Working closely with internal teams to coordinate logistics activities and resolve supply chain challenges. Training and Development: Engaging in learning opportunities to build expertise in logistics and supply chain management. Skills You Bring: Strong analytical and problem-solving skills to interpret logistics data and identify process improvement opportunities. Proficiency in Microsoft Excel, including pivot tables and formulas, for data analysis and reporting. Experience with ERP systems (e.g., SAP, Oracle, or similar) for inventory tracking, order processing, and logistics coordination. Knowledge of international shipping and customs regulations, especially relevant to chemical or manufacturing industries. Basic understanding of supply chain principles, including inventory control, demand planning, and vendor management.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, including proficiency in English, to collaborate effectively with internal teams, global stakeholders, and external partners. Attention to detail and accuracy in handling documentation, compliance records, and inventory data. Ability to work independently and man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.
